Al Arabi seal Marco Verratti deal

DOHA, Sep 11: Paris Saint-Germain legend Marco Verratti is set to seal a move to Al Arabi in Qatar.
Verratti has held extensive talks with PSG and new boss Luis Enrique about his future, deciding now is the time to bring down the curtain on his glittering career at Parc des Princes. Over 11 years, the Italian has played 416 games and won 21 trophies, including nine Ligue 1 titles.
Enrique was keen for 30-year-old Verratti to remain, but the player’s mind was made up after becoming unsettled over the summer treatment of his former and current team-mates, primarily Neymar and Kylian Mbappe.
Verratti was the subject of enquiries from clubs around Europe with Manchester City, Chelsea, Bayern among those keeping a watching brief on the situation. But he showed little desire to stay back in Europe. (Agencies)
